Primary Catalysts for Global Logistic Software Market Growth
The significant and sustained Logistic Software Market Growth is being fueled by a powerful set of interconnected catalysts, with the most dominant being the global explosion of e-commerce. The paradigm shift in consumer buying habits towards online channels has completely reshaped supply chain and fulfillment expectations. Today's consumers demand not just fast and free shipping but also complete transparency, with real-time tracking and precise delivery windows. This has created an environment of unprecedented complexity and urgency for businesses. To meet these demands, companies must operate highly efficient, accurate, and responsive logistics networks. This is simply not achievable with manual processes or outdated spreadsheets, making the adoption of modern, integrated logistics software a fundamental requirement for any business that sells goods online.
A second major catalyst for growth is the increasing complexity and inherent fragility of globalized supply chains. As companies source materials and manufacture products across a vast network of international suppliers, their exposure to potential disruptions—from geopolitical events and trade disputes to natural disasters and port congestion—has grown exponentially. This has elevated the need for supply chain resilience and agility to a top-level executive priority. Logistics software provides the critical end-to-end visibility that is the prerequisite for building this resilience. By providing a real-time, centralized view of inventory, shipments, and carrier capacity, these platforms empower companies to anticipate potential problems, quickly adapt to changing conditions, and pivot to alternative sourcing or transportation strategies when disruptions occur.
The relentless and ever-present pressure to control operational costs and improve efficiency serves as a third, equally compelling catalyst for market growth. The logistics function is one of the largest cost centers for most businesses, with transportation, warehousing, and labor representing significant expenses. Logistics software offers a direct and powerful means of controlling these costs. A Transportation Management System (TMS) can reduce freight spend by 10-20% through intelligent route optimization and load consolidation. A Warehouse Management System (WMS) can dramatically improve labor productivity and inventory accuracy, reducing carrying costs and minimizing expensive order errors. This clear, quantifiable, and often rapid return on investment (ROI) provides a powerful and easily justifiable business case for investing in the technology.
